Materials That Make Skeleton Costumes Last
Choosing the right materials ensures your costume is not only visually striking but also comfortable and durable.
Best Materials for Skeleton Costumes:
- Foam & Wire Frames: Lightweight yet sturdy alternatives to traditional bones; ideal for 3D skeleton shapes.
- Tulle & Mesh: Soft, flowing fabrics perfect for flowing fabrics or adding layered “limb” effects.
- Latex or Foam Latex: For realistic, durable skeletal details with painting finish.
- String & Wire: Used to create floating body parts or spatial tension in posed displays.
- Cardboard & Fabric: Great for hand-crafted props or structural elements that can be stitched or glued.
Pro Tip: Always test movement and breathability—effective costumes must balance aesthetics with wearability!
